Managing Your Prescriptions Online
Costco Mail Order offers a robust online portal at pharmacy.costco.com. This is your central hub for all things prescription-related. Here, you can set up a profile account if you haven't already, which is a straightforward process. Once logged in, you can submit new prescriptions, request refills, and even track the status of your orders. This proactive approach means you're always in control, and there's no need to worry about a prescription being held indefinitely without your knowledge.
Refill Reminders and Auto-Refill
To further simplify things and prevent any gaps in your medication, Costco Mail Order provides an auto-refill reminder program. By signing up for this, you'll receive notifications when it's time to request a refill, ensuring you don't run out. If you have an online account and an email address on file, you'll receive automated emails when prescriptions are processed and shipped. For those without an email on file, an automated call will notify you when an order has shipped.
What if You Need to Transfer?
Sometimes, your pharmacy needs change. If your pharmacy has switched to Costco Mail Order, it's important to inform your prescriber. If you're transitioning from another pharmacy, Costco, in conjunction with Capital Rx, may work to transfer your prescriptions. If you have any concerns about whether all your prescriptions were transferred, a call to Capital Rx is recommended. They can help confirm that everything is in order.
Support When You Need It
Should you have questions or need assistance, Costco Mail Order offers customer support. You can reach them by phone, often by calling the number on your ID card, and following the prompts for home-delivered medications. Their support hours are Monday through Friday from 8:00 AM to 10:00 PM EST, and Saturdays from 12:30 PM to 5:00 PM EST. The website pharmacy.costco.com is also a valuable resource, with a member portal that's getting a visual refresh in early June 2025, promising a cleaner, more modern feel without changing your login details or the website URL.
